Data from NIST Standard Reference Database … See more Acetone is incompatible with concentrated nitric and sulfuric acid mixtures. It may also explode when mixed with chloroform in the presence of a base. When oxidized, for example by reacting with hydrogen peroxide, it forms acetone peroxide, which is a highly unstable, primary explosive compound. It may be formed accidentally, e.g. when waste hydrogen peroxide is poured into waste solvent containing acetone.
